• 特朗普再与世界"为敌" 多国斥其关于耶路撒冷决定 2018-06-22
  • 严防“两节”期间“四风”反弹 持续保持高压态势 2018-06-22
  • 反转!华南理工大学否认向莱阳14岁神童发送考察函 2018-06-21
  • 中国出版集团公司总裁谭跃委员:唱响新时代的好声音 2018-06-21
  • 新華網評:分享經濟,別演成分享的“獨角戲” 2018-06-20
  • 红薯会越放越甜吗 如何保存红薯最科学? 2018-06-20
  • 猪肉创八年新低部分养殖户巨亏离场 行业加速洗牌 2018-06-19
  • 招商证券:创业板反弹压力逐渐显现 2018-06-19
  • “一拖二快三”足球比分直400余名应届大学毕业生成为部队“准警官” 2018-06-19
  • 男子累计献血20万毫升 获选江苏"最美志愿者" 2018-06-19
  • 欧米茄全新推出新西兰酋长队腕表 2018-06-19
  • 財政部發文要求清理“有照無證”會計師事務所 2018-06-19
  • 八旬老人街头贴纸条求收养 称儿子同意其找人抚养 2018-06-18
  • 全国政协委员许鸿飞:让中国文化走出去 2018-06-18
  • 《谈判官》杨幂曝爱情观金句 演绎独立新女性获赞 2018-06-18
  • php 发邮件(使用phpmailer类)

    栏目: 编程语言 发布于: 2014-04-25 15:30:01

    利用php中的phpmailer发送邮件的示例,示例代码以及该示例的页面效果如下,另外文章的末尾提供了phpmailer文件的下载地址,该文件里面有许多发送邮件的例子,不过都是英文的。

    具体代码:

    <html xmlns="http://www.rocksun.cn/php-function/378.html">
    <head>
    <me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
    <title>利用phpmailer发送电子邮件</title>
    <?php
    if(isset($_POST['email'])&&trim($_POST['email'])!=''){
    	require "class.phpmailer.php";
    	$mail=new PHPMailer();
    	$address=$_POST['email'];
    	$mail->IsSMTP();//使用SMTP方式发送
    	$mail->Host="mail.xxxxx.com";//您的企业邮局域名
    	$mail->SMTPAuth=true;//启用SMTP验证功能
    	$mail->Username="user@xxxx.com";//邮局用户名(请填写完整的email地址)
    	$mail->Password="******";//邮局密码
    	$mail->From="user@xxxx.com";//邮件发送者email地址
    	$mail->FromName="您的名称";
    	$mail->AddAddress($address,"");//AddAddress("收件人email","收件人姓名")
    	//$mail->AddReplyTo("","");//http://www.rocksun.cn/php-function/378.html
    	//$mail->AddAttachment("/var/tmp/file.tar.gz");//添加附件
    	//$mail->IsHTML(true);//set email format to HTML //是否使用HTML格式
    	$mail->Subject=$_POST['title'];//邮件标题
    	$mail->Body=$_POST['content'];//邮件内容
    	$mail->AltBody='';//附加信息,可以省略
    	if(!$mail->Send()){
    		echo "邮件发送失败。 <p>";
    		echo "错误原因:".$mail->ErrorInfo;
    	}else{
    		echo "邮件发送成功";
    	}
    }
    ?>
    </head>
    <body>
    <h3>phpmailer Email 发送</h3>
    <form name="phpmailer" action="index.php" method="post">
    <input type="hidden" name="submitted" value="1"/>
    邮件地址: <input type="text" size="50" name="email" />
    <br/>
    邮件标题: <input type="text" size="50" name="title" />
    <br/>
    邮件信息:
    <textarea name="content" id="content" cols="45" rows="5"></textarea>
    <br />
    <input type="submit" value="发送"/>
    </form>
    </body>
    </html>

    phpmailer 文件下载

    本站文章除注明转载外,均为本站原创或编译?;队魏涡问降淖?,但请务必注明出处。
    转载请注明:文章转载自 七星彩票平台
    本文标题:php 发邮件(使用phpmailer类)
    IT技术书籍推荐:
    PHP编程(第3版)
    PHP编程(第3版)
    凯文·塔特罗 (Kevin Tatroe) (作者), 彼得·麦金太尔 (Peter MacIntyre) (作者), 拉斯马斯·勒多夫 (Rasmus Lerdorf) (作者), 赵戈戈 (译者), 易国磐 (译者), 张鹏飞 (译者)
    这是一本可以让读者深入了解PHP 技术的书籍,作者用言简意赅的语言并结合了大量实例来解释每一个要素。本书涵盖了PHP 所有基本的要点,不管你是一个想从头开始学习PHP的人,还是对PHP 已经有了基础想继续深入的人,这本书都很合适。